What is the saying about eating rice cakes on New Year's Day?Nian Gao is also called sticky cake, which means getting taller every year. In the south it is made from glutinous rice, in the north it is made from sticky millet.Rice cakes have a long history. In the Han Dynasty, rice cakes were already known as "rice cakes", "cakes", "bait" and "ci". The recipe for making rice cake "white cocoon sugar" was recorded in the 6th century cookbook "Shi Ci", and the method of grinding rice into powder and making cakes was recorded in the Northern Dynasty's "Qi Min Yao Shu". Eating rice cakes on New Year's Day was popular during the Ming and Qing dynasties, especially in the south. Volume 2 of "A Brief Account of Scenery in the Imperial Capital" from the late Ming Dynasty records that on the first day of the first lunar month, "people wake up early, wash their hands, eat date cakes, and rice cakes." The "Weixian Chronicles" during the Jiajing period in northern Hebei Province said that the local people ate "steamed mutton cake". In the south, Suzhou and Jiading in Jiangsu and Zhejiang call it "jiegao". The "Qiongtaizhi" of Guangdong in the Zhengde period of the Ming Dynasty records that people eat spring cakes locally: "Before New Year's Day, spring cakes are steamed in a basket with glutinous rice flour, sugar or ash juice. The diameter is about one foot and the thickness is five or six inches. Various fruits are mixed in the annual sacrifice. People cut them and make New Year tea as gifts. "Its shape is similar to today's birthday cake. Volume 12 of Gu Lu's "Qing Jia Lu" in the Qing Dynasty recorded it in more detail, saying that millet flour and sugar were made into cakes, called "nian gao", which came in yellow and white. The large one, which is one foot square, is called "square-head cake", and there are also "cake ingots" that look like ingots, which are used for offerings on New Year's Eve and as gifts between relatives and friends. In addition, there are long and thin "tiaotou cake" and wide "tiaoban cake". New Year's Day TagsChinese name: New Year's Day. Foreign name: NEW YEAR.
